Mid-air collisions are an area of vital concern to everyone who flies an airplane. Because of increasing general aviation traffic and concentrations of military aircraft involved in training, RAFs Mildenhall and Lakenheath are committed to maintaining a strong, active mid-air collision avoidance (MACA) program. The number of incidents between Air Force aircraft and general aviation aircraft is relatively low; however, 80 percent of reported Air Force near misses occur with general aviation aircraft. The purpose of this Web page is to alert you to the many areas of high mid-air collision potential in the skies over East Anglia, to discuss ways to make them safer, and describe the types of military aircraft you may encounter, arrival and departure routes, and military operating areas. You will find information on mid-air collisions and ways to help avoid them. We hope this site will increase your understanding of our flying activities so we may continue to safely share the skies.


Note: MACA pages are intended for informational purposes only and are not regulatory in nature.
